Minibrute 2 & External Filter demo - Using Ripples with 'Ext' audio input
Published on Dec 26, 2018 DreamsOfWires
"A demo/example of how to incorporate an alternative filter with your Minibrute 2, in this case a Eurorack modular VCF - Mutable Instruments Ripples. Not a musical piece, just an audio example. Turn on Subtitles for a step-by-step explanation, and see the end of the description for patch notes.
There is much more you can do with this kind of setup, especially with the Brute's patch bay, and more so with the Minibrute 2s, but this was just an experiment really - I always wondered what my old Minibrute SE would sound like through a Roland-style filter. Ripples isn't necessarily the closest filter I have to that style, but it's popular, so I thought it might be useful to more people as a point of reference.

Korg DW-6000 Review and Tutorial
Published on Dec 26, 2018 synthlegends
"My short demonstration of a very interesting and affordable Synth. This synth is very simple but sounds great and very "analogue", although it is digital. It has very simple 8 sample based waveforms and an analog filter. There are 2 OSC and Noise."
